Our Lady Star of the Sea, Stella Maris, is the patroness of the men who sail the seas. Saint Bonaventure reminds us that she also "guides to a landfall in heaven those who navigate the sea of this world in the ship of innocence or penance." Ships at sea might be guided by the North Star. Our Lady, Star of the Sea, aids not only the sailors aboard those ships, she also aids all those who sail the stormy seas of life.

Next Twelve Beads:
The twelve beads on the loop represent the twelve stars on Our Lady's Crown.
On each of the 12 beads pray one Hail Mary followed by the invocation Our Lady, Star of the Sea, help and protect us! Sweet Mother, I place this cause in your hand.
